Horrible Terrible Play. Did I misplay every street?
 
I felt stuck in this hand. Anyhow, Party Poker 2/4. Five people just sat down.

I am second to act, UTG calls, and I call with
A [img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img]Q [img]/images/graemlins/club.gif[/img]
3 more callers, and a raiser. 1 fold, its back to me and I call, next person calls, and than a limp-reraise. Everyone calls.

6 people to the flop for $24

T [img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img]6 [img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img]Q : [img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img]

Checked to me, I bet out, 1 caller, limp-re-raiser raises, and all but 1 call.

About $45 in the pot now.

Turn is the 3 [img]/images/graemlins/heart.gif[/img]
Checked to the Limp Re-raiser who bets, and the three of us call.

River is 2 [img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img]

One of the scarier cards in the deck.

Checked the the Limp Reraiser who bets. Next person calls, I overcall, person behind me folds.

Opinions on all streets gratly appreciated. I think I misplayed every street, but I am not sure.

hi huh
pre-flop, you're in raise or fold country. if you're going to play, then raise and hope to get heads up against the limper. if the limper is solid, fold pre-flop.

tough to say. i think you can go for a check-raise, but i like how you played the flop. the only thing is that you should reraise the raiser. you would likely get another fold, and you want to get heads up on the turn. middle pockets may be sticking around until the turn only, so you want to make them pay. you also have value in reraising, so you don't mind getting more bets in there.

the turn and river are fine.
